This bronze Kusunoki Masashige Statue is in the city park, outside of the Imperial Palace in Tokyo Japan. The statue was commissioned by the Japanese government around 1880 and took workers 2 years to build. Kusunoki was an ancient Japanese hero that became the patron saint of Kamikaze pilots during WWII.

"Sendai, Japan, October 31st 2006: A bust of the Daimyo Date Masamune which founded the Sendai city in 1600. Today Sendai is the capital city in Miyagi Prefecture in Japan and the biggest city in Tohoku Region. On 11 March 2011, a 9.0 earthquake and a subsequent major tsunami hit Sendai, causing major damage to the city, especially on the coastal area including Sendai Airport and Port."
